What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Newark Liberty Airport to Uganda?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Newark Airport to Uganda cl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Uganda on a Wednesday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Saturday is the most expensive day to fly from Newark Liberty Airport to Uganda.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Wednesday and avoiding Sundays for the best deals.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Uganda?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Uganda is generally at night, when round-trip flights cost $974 on average. Morning departures are around 11%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Uganda is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,359.
